Redis 鍵值儲存開啟大數據之旅
在當今數據驅動的世界中,如何有效地存儲和管理大量數據成為了企業成功的關鍵。Redis,作為一種高效的鍵值儲存系統,正逐漸成為大數據處理的首選工具。本文將探討Redis的基本概念、特性以及如何利用它開啟大數據之旅。
什麼是Redis?
Redis(Remote Dictionary Server)是一個開源的鍵值儲存系統,主要用於數據的快速存取。它支持多種數據結構,包括字符串、哈希、列表、集合和有序集合等。由於其高效的性能和靈活的數據模型,Redis被廣泛應用於緩存、消息隊列和實時數據分析等場景。
Redis的特性
- 高性能:Redis能夠每秒處理數十萬次的請求,這使得它在需要快速響應的應用中表現出色。
- 持久化:Redis支持將數據持久化到磁碟,這意味著即使在系統重啟後,數據也不會丟失。
- 靈活的數據結構:Redis支持多種數據結構,這使得開發者可以根據需求選擇最合適的數據模型。
- 分佈式架構:Redis可以輕鬆地擴展到多個節點,支持大規模的數據存儲和處理。
Redis在大數據中的應用
隨著數據量的激增,企業需要更高效的方式來處理和分析數據。Redis在大數據領域的應用主要體現在以下幾個方面:
1. 實時數據分析
Redis的高性能特性使其成為實時數據分析的理想選擇。企業可以利用Redis來存儲和分析即時數據流,例如網站訪問量、用戶行為等。通過Redis的數據結構,開發者可以快速查詢和更新數據,從而實現即時的數據洞察。
2. 緩存系統
在大數據環境中,數據的讀取速度至關重要。Redis可以作為緩存系統,將頻繁訪問的數據存儲在內存中,從而顯著提高數據的讀取速度。這不僅減少了對後端數據庫的壓力,還能提升用戶體驗。
3. 消息隊列
Redis的列表和集合數據結構使其能夠輕鬆實現消息隊列功能。企業可以利用Redis來處理異步任務,例如用戶註冊、訂單處理等,從而提高系統的整體效率。
如何開始使用Redis
要開始使用Redis,首先需要安裝Redis服務器。以下是基本的安裝步驟:
sudo apt update
sudo apt install redis-server
安裝完成後,可以通過以下命令啟動Redis服務:
sudo systemctl start redis
接下來,可以使用Redis的命令行界面進行基本操作,例如:
redis-cli
SET key "value"
GET key
結論
Redis作為一種高效的鍵值儲存系統,為企業在大數據時代提供了強大的支持。無論是實時數據分析、緩存系統還是消息隊列,Redis都能夠幫助企業更好地管理和利用數據。隨著大數據技術的不斷發展,Redis的應用前景將更加廣闊。
如果您對於如何在您的業務中實施Redis或其他相關技術有興趣,歡迎訪問我們的網站了解更多資訊,探索我們的VPS解決方案,助您在大數據的旅程中更進一步。